[mono-reflection] Change paths for mono assemblies according to updated packaging guidelines (http://fedoraproject.org
Christian Krause
chkr at fedoraproject.org
Sun Nov 13 11:03:40 UTC 2011
commit 184a292c3265b7aee4c7fcc4bd0cf49a3e675c3b
Author: Christian Krause <chkr at fedoraproject.org>
Date: Sun Nov 13 12:03:33 2011 +0100
Change paths for mono assemblies according to updated packaging
guidelines (http://fedoraproject.org/wiki/Packaging:Mono)
mono-reflection.pc | 2 +-
mono-reflection.spec | 14 +++++++++-----
2 files changed, 10 insertions(+), 6 deletions(-)
---
diff --git a/mono-reflection.pc b/mono-reflection.pc
index d3f129e..423586b 100644
--- a/mono-reflection.pc
+++ b/mono-reflection.pc
@@ -1,6 +1,6 @@
prefix=/usr
exec_prefix=${prefix}
-libdir=@libdir@
+libdir=${prefix}/lib
Name: mono-reflection
Description: mono-reflection - Helper Library for Mono Reflection support
diff --git a/mono-reflection.spec b/mono-reflection.spec
index b5f2e5d..836ee32 100644
--- a/mono-reflection.spec
+++ b/mono-reflection.spec
@@ -4,7 +4,7 @@
Name: mono-reflection
Version: 0.1
-Release: 0.2.%{gitdate}git%{gitrev}%{?dist}
+Release: 0.3.%{gitdate}git%{gitrev}%{?dist}
Summary: Helper library for Mono Reflection support
URL: https://github.com/jbevain/mono.reflection
License: MIT
@@ -51,18 +51,22 @@ make LIBDIR=%{_libdir}
mkdir -p %{buildroot}%{_libdir}/pkgconfig
cp -p %{SOURCE1} %{buildroot}%{_libdir}/pkgconfig
sed -i -e 's!@libdir@!%{_libdir}!' $RPM_BUILD_ROOT/%{_libdir}/pkgconfig/mono-reflection.pc
-mkdir -p %{buildroot}%{_libdir}/mono/gac/
-gacutil -i bin/Mono.Reflection.dll -f -package Mono.Reflection -root %{buildroot}%{_libdir}
+mkdir -p %{buildroot}%{_prefix}/lib/mono/gac/
+gacutil -i bin/Mono.Reflection.dll -f -package Mono.Reflection -root %{buildroot}%{_prefix}/lib
%files
%doc README
-%{_libdir}/mono/gac/Mono.Reflection/
-%{_libdir}/mono/Mono.Reflection/
+%{_prefix}/lib/mono/gac/Mono.Reflection/
+%{_prefix}/lib/mono/Mono.Reflection/
%files devel
%{_libdir}/pkgconfig/mono-reflection.pc
%changelog
+* Sun Nov 13 2011 Christian Krause <chkr at fedoraproject.org> - 0.1-0.3.20110613git304d1d
+- Change paths for mono assemblies according to updated packaging
+ guidelines (http://fedoraproject.org/wiki/Packaging:Mono)
+
* Mon Jun 13 2011 Tom Callaway <spot at fedoraproject.org> - 0.1-0.2.20110613git304d1d
- add script to generate tarball
- correct git revision
More information about the scm-commits
mailing list